Problems with patching 2.7 are no longer relevant.
To test, we should refactor config so that the attempt to find and access $HOME and .idlerc are isolated in a function that can be mocked to simulate various problems.
def get_rc():
"""Return a directory path that is readable and writable.
If not possible, return an error indicator. <to be determined>
"""
Testing such a function is a different issue, but I would just reuse existing code. |
